Sudden death of woman in Scarborough not being treated as suspicious

North Yorkshire Police has confirmed it is not treating the sudden death of a woman in Scarborough today as suspicious.

Police were contacted at 9.12am on Thursday April 30 by ambulance services who had attended the sudden death of a woman at a property on Friars Way, Scarborough.

The road was temporarily cordoned off and several police vehicles and an ambulance were at the scene.

Officers are conducting enquiries to determine the circumstances around her death, which is not being treated as suspicious.

The woman’s next of kin have been informed.
